Abstract

The invention discloses a kind of liquid fertilizers and preparation method thereof for effectively facilitating sweet precious watermelon growth of flower bud, which includes 1000 parts of active liquid fertilizer substrate preparation;32 ~ 48 parts of nitrogen, 5 ~ 16 parts of potassium, 11 ~ 23 parts of phosphorus, 10 ~ 20 parts of sulphur, 5 ~ 12 parts of boron, 3 ~ 9 parts of zinc, 0.1 ~ 5 part of manganese, 0.1 ~ 5 part of magnesium;Contain 0.1 ~ 5 part of diethyl aminoethyl hexanoate, 20 ~ 32 parts of glycine, 9 ~ 15 parts of methionine, 1 ~ 10 part of lysine, 10 ~ 18 parts of phenylalanine in the liquid fertilizer;The liquid fertilizer has not only effectively facilitated the flower bud development of sweet precious watermelon, while having selectivity to the bud differentiation of different melon vines, the most significant to the bud differentiation effect of sweet precious watermelon.

Background technique
Sweet treasured watermelon also known as platform are black, young fruit period fruit face bottle green, and green color stripe is indistinctly presented, and there is white in mature consequence face Fruit powder.Single melon weighs 6~7 jin, and big person is up to 12 jin or so.Skin depth about 1.2~1.5, storage tolerance.Plant strain growth is medium, and branch is more, Fruit setting power is strong, is medium variety.Melon pulp large red, quality is fine and close, and sweet, matter is good.Seed is small, light brown, but quantity is more.Cause The easy branch of the kind, fruit setting is more, so being that macronutrient is needed to supply in cultivation.
Streptomyces (streptomyces) is a category for Actinomycetal.Substrate mycelium is not broken, and aerial hyphae usually sends out Educate good, the fibrillae of spores of formation long (sometimes short).Spore cannot move, and often have the shapes jewelry such as wart, thorn or hair on epitheca.Strepto- Bacterium is widely present in soil, is Filamentous gram-positive bacterium, mainly by sporogenesis, most streptomycetes are to people Body is harmless.Streptomycete is the main source for generating various antibiotic, the antibiotic derived from streptomycete include erythromycin, tetracycline, Streptomysin, chloramphenicol, neomycin, nystatin, kanamycins, cycloheximide and anphotericin etc., therefore, for streptomycete Existing research focuses primarily upon bacterial strain and generates ability and size of antibacterial substance etc..
Sweet treasured watermelon vine bud differentiation refers to that axis growing point mitogenetic blade, axillary bud out are changed into and differentiates inflorescence or flower Piece process, bud differentiation is the physiology and morphological landmarks changed from nutrient growth to reproductive growth.Bud differentiation directly affects To yielding positive results for plant, therefore flower bud differentiation period has directly established the base of fruiting period and harvest time to the nutritional supplementation of plant Plinth.Often occur that bud differentiation is slow, and branch is few during sweet precious growth of watermelon, causes result few, fruit is small.

The separation and identification of 1 streptomyces bacterial strain of embodiment (Streptomyces)
1. experimental material and condition
(1) in the collected pedotheque in Hunan Province Chenzhou City somewhere.
(2) every liter of component of fluid nutrient medium is as follows: beef extract 3.0g, peptone 10.0g, sodium chloride 5.0g, water are settled to 1 It rises, pH 7.5.
Every liter of component of solid medium is as follows: beef extract 3.0g, peptone 10.0g, sodium chloride 5.0g, agar 15~ 25g, water are settled to 1 liter, pH 7.5.
Culture medium packing, high-pressure sterilizing pot sterilize (121 DEG C, 30min).
(3) aseptic technique: all vessel and apparatus must sterilize (121 DEG C, 30min) through high-pressure sterilizing pot, inoculation Equal operations carry out in superclean bench.
(4) strain culturing condition: being placed in culture in 25 ± 1 DEG C of illumination insulating boxs (14L:10D), after bacterium colony is formed, turns The inclined-plane PDA is moved on to, then is transferred in 5 DEG C of refrigerators and saves.
2. strain isolation and screening
(1) separation obtains a streptomycete category bacterial strain T0 from the pedotheque in Hunan Province Chenzhou City somewhere.
(2) by inclined-plane squamous subculture in isolated streptomyces bacterial strain T0 access solid medium, then 5 DEG C of ice are transferred to It is saved in case.
(3) by the bacterial strain T0 of squamous subculture in fluid nutrient medium, 220 revs/min on oscillation shaking table, 25 DEG C of conditions Lower culture 5 days.
(4) the T0 liquid bacteria after cultivating 5 days, is placed at 20 watts of ultraviolet radiator 25cm and irradiates 2 hours.
(5) it will be cultivated 5 days in the T0 liquid bacteria access solid slope culture medium after irradiation 25 DEG C, then choose and grow most Good surviving colonies access solid medium squamous subculture.
(6) several processes all over step (2)~(5) are repeated to recycle.Each in repetitive process circulation, solid medium All increase by 1 gram with the sodium chloride dosage in fluid nutrient medium, until the sodium chloride dosage in solid medium and fluid nutrient medium Reach 25 grams.The healthy and strong bacterial strain finally survived is subjected to squamous subculture, then is transferred in 5 DEG C of refrigerators and saves.
(7) the osmophilic strain bacterial strain T0 that will be filtered out above carries out fermentation production run.Through 7 days 25 DEG C open wide it is aerobic After fermentation, amino nitrogen in fermentation liquid (measuring ammonia nitrogen standard detection by formol titration) is measured, amino nitrogen is picked out and contains (>=0.7mg/L) highest bacterial strain is measured as final production bacterial strain, is named " TY-001# ".
Culture medium used in fermentation production run is as follows: taking soybean 100g to wear into soya-bean milk filtering, abandons bean dregs;White granulated sugar 100g is settled to 1000mL, pH 7.5.
3. the identification of bacterial strain " TY-001# "
(1) Morphological Identification
Morphological feature are as follows: bacterium colony is rounded, milky, the smooth of the edge, shows there is condensed milk shape gloss;Spore Gram's staining It is positive.
Morphological Identification shows that the bacterial strain belongs to streptomyces.
In conclusion bacterial strain " TY-001# " is streptomyces, Guangdong Province's microbial bacteria is preserved on March 24th, 2017 Kind collection, deposit number are GDMCC No.:60152, and preservation address is that the province of GuangZhou, China city martyr Road 100 is micro- Biological five building, institute's laboratory building.

Effectively facilitate the application effect appraisal of the liquid fertilizer of sweet precious watermelon growth of flower bud:
Nutrient needed for liquid fertilizer can quickly supplement the growth of fruit rattan promotes the precious watermelon vine bud differentiation of honey.Originally for verifying The actual effect of liquid fertilizer large-scale demonstration application on sweet precious watermelon fruit rattan of preparation is invented, applicant selects in sweet Bao Xi Experiment and demonstration has been carried out on melon.
1 materials and methods
1.1 are located in the precious watermelon base of Zixing City's honey for examination place 1,12 mu of testing ground area, soil fertility level compared with Uniformly.
For examination place 2 be located in Jianning city early spring carbuncle watermelon base, 12 mu of testing ground area, soil fertility level compared with Uniformly.
1.2 for studying the precious watermelon of the honey of object 1, rattan line-spacing 0.6m*1m, the growing way golden mean of the Confucian school and consistent.
For studying object 2 early spring carbuncle watermelon, rattan line-spacing 0.6m*1m, the growing way golden mean of the Confucian school and consistent.
1.3 for trying the liquid fertilizer that fertilizer is the precious watermelon bud differentiation of honey made from embodiment 2~5, and product forms are liquid Body.
1.4 it is each for examination place carry out 3 test process:
1. experimental group: it pours within every 3 months after plantation and applies once for trying fertilizer, it is 500mL/ mus each, dilute 200 times.
2. control group (CK): per acre every time with the progress of same experimental group equivalent clear water same time, other measures of fertilizer are the same as processing ①。
3. comparative example group: being carried out every time with the chemical fertilizer same time prepared by the comparative example 1 of same experimental group equivalent per acre, other are applied The same processing of fertile measure is 1..
Experimental group and control group, comparative example group are managed by local conventional cultivation technology.Each processing is tested with per acre It for cell, is repeated 3 times, management is consistent.Each group randomly selects 10 plants of melon vine measurement bud differentiation situations, acquires average value.
2 results and analysis
2.1 different disposals are to young sprout growth, the influence of bud rate and flower number
As shown in Table 1, after applying the liquid fertilizer, the new-tip length and rugosity of watermelon are significantly higher than control group, length 27.3% is increased, rugosity increases 20.3%.In terms of bud rate, which increases the bud rate of watermelon 15.7%, flower number increases 40.0%, achieves unexpected technical effect.However, the liquid fertilizer is to early spring carbuncle The growth of flower bud of watermelon does not all play substantive effect.As it can be seen that the bud differentiation of liquid fertilizer of the invention to different melon vines It is the most significant to the bud differentiation effect of sweet precious watermelon with selectivity.
